Abbie Ln - streets of Glen Rose (Texas).
Explore "Abbie Ln" on the map of Glen Rose in street view mode
Click on the buttons below to display the map of Abbie Ln, Glen Rose, United States
Search street by name:
Tags:
Abbie Ln on the map of Glen Rose,
Glen Rose satellite view, Glen Rose street view.